About Roberta Piket

Roberta Piket (born 1965) is an American jazz pianist, organist, composer, and arranger. Piket was born in Queens, New York, in 1965. Her father was composer Frederick Piket. She started playing the piano at the age of 7 and moved to jazz in her early teens. A university joint double-degree program led to her receiving a computer science degree from Tufts University and a jazz studies degree from the New England Conservatory of Music.While at university, she took private lessons from Stanley Cowell, Fred Hersch, Jim McNeely, and Bob Moses.
